基于支持向量机的早期聚合物驱动态预测研究

摘    要:海上稠油油田由于受到开采时间的限制,一般在含水率达到40%之前进行聚合物驱,以提高油藏采油速度和开发效果,开发动态与陆上油田高含水期聚合物驱存在较大差异。文中应用统计方法,分析海上稠油油田早期聚合物驱的生产动态,从数据序列分析的角度研究其动态规律,认识不同动态参数之间的内在联系;基于支持向量机方法,建立时间与含水率、采出程度等动态参数之间的变化关系,并根据实际动态资料及时修正,进而建立能够反映早期注聚合物规律的预测方法。利用建立的预测模型,对渤海油田典型聚合物驱油藏进行实例计算分析。结果表明,建立的模型能够实现时间序列的多步预测,且预测结果满足精度要求,为早期聚合物驱开发指标预测和动态适时调控提供了一种有效的方法。

Development index prediction of early polymer flooding based on support vector machine

Abstract:Due to the limits of development time in offshore heavy oilfield, in general, polymer flooding is used to improve the production rate and development effect before the water cut reaches 40%. However, there are differences in production performance comoared with polymer flooding of onshore thin oil oilfield at high water cut stage. Statistical method was applied to analyze theproduction performance of early polymer flooding in offshore heavy oil oiffield, and dynamic laws and development trends of early polymer flooding were studied from the perspective of data sequence analysis to reveal the internal relations among different dynamic parameters. The change relations among water cut, recovery percentage and production time were constructed based on support vector machine, corrected in time according to actual dynamic data. At last a forecast method to reflect development law of early polymer flooding was established. A case of typical polymer flooding reservoir was analyzed in Bohai oilfields through the use of established forecast model. Results show that the model can fulfill the muhistep prediction of time series, and the prediction results can meet the accuracy requirement, which provides an effective method to predict the development index of early polymer flooding and adjust the reservoir performance in time.
